Q: How is the operation type chosen for multi port ball valves in Vadodara?
A: The operation type-lever, gear, or actuator-is selected based on the system requirements and level of automation needed. For manual control, levers are preferred; gear operators aid in handling larger valves, while actuators-pneumatic or electric-are ideal for automated and remote control applications.
Q: What are the benefits of utilizing multi port ball valves in industrial processes?
A: Multi port ball valves enable efficient flow diversion, mixing, and distribution within a single device, reducing space, installation points, and potential leakage sources. They are especially valuable in chemical, petrochemical, water treatment, and HVAC sectors due to their robust construction and ease of use.
Q: When should I choose a floating ball versus a trunnion mounted ball type?
A: Floating ball valves are suited for lower pressure applications, offering tight sealing for general industrial use. Trunnion mounted ball valves are preferred for high pressure environments and larger sizes, where the ball requires additional support to maintain operational integrity and reduce torque requirements.

Q: How does the choice of seat and body material affect valve performance?
A: Selecting appropriate seat and body materials, such as PTFE for chemical resistance or CF8M for superior corrosion resistance, ensures valve longevity and reliability. Material choice is influenced by media type, temperature, and environmental demands of the application.
